Output 59ba156604a63e48bffeb6732baf466a01274ce1a97e2616650cfbbc2d3d9726:1

value
13200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f43d588635d6957984d55eff01e203bd70a974e OP_EQUAL
address
38v8ZtsQnRVSK62LQP8dNqXWAtQvZJGDmP
transaction
59ba156604a63e48bffeb6732baf466a01274ce1a97e2616650cfbbc2d3d9726
spent
true